   European Stars and Stripes (Newspaper) - September 19, 1989, Darmstadt, Hesse                                Page 2 the stars and stripes tuesday september 19.1989 news updates sikh violence Amritsar India a suspected sikh extremists killed eight members of a sikh family in renewed violence that claimed 12 lives in Northern Punjab slate police said Friday. Six militants armed with Auto malic assault rifles raided the farmhouse of Dilar Singh in a Sool Pur Village about 90 Miles South of Amritsar. Late thursday and killed Singh and seven other family members said Surjit Singh a senior District police official. The victims included the Farmer s wife and his parents he said. Police offered no theories As to the reason for the killings but sikh Mili Tants often kill moderate sikhs who do not sympathize with their cause. Sol Idarnos creator Columbus Ohio a the creator of the sol Idarnos ban Ner of the polish Trade Union Soli Darity is adopting another Flag. Kazimirz Bascik. 47, is to take the oath of . Citizenship tues Day in a ceremony at the slate House in Columbus. Bascik created the Solidarity logo the word sol Idarnos inbred with the while and Rcd polish Flag flying from it in 1980,when the organization became the first legalized Trade Union in the East bloc. The next year Bascik visited col Umbus and Ohio state University but. While he was on his Way Home Poland s communist government imposed martial Law. Bascik move to West Germany then returned to Columbus. When his Mother Cecy Lia Bascik was allowed to Immi grate they settled in Clintonville a suburb North of the City. Frank hired other prostitutes but says i knew it was wrong new York a rep. Barney Frank says Stephen Gobie was t the Only prostitute he had relations with even though the congressman believed it was wrong to Padroni a them. In an interview with Newsweek mag Azine the Massachusetts Democrat also denied claims that he acknowledged his homosexuality because he was afraid Gobic would blackmail him. He was t the first prostitute i had used Frank said. I just could t live that Way anymore. I was tired of looking Over my shoulder. I met Herb Moses. Frank s companion about that  Frank added i knew it was wrong for me to be hiring prostitutes from time to time. Gobic was t the Only one. I knew it was wrong but i could t sit  the interview is published in the sept. 25 Issue of Newsweek which was on Newsstands monday. The congressman said that he never risked contracting aids i was t sexually Active in the old Days. By the time i was sexually Active i knew bet Ter. I knew about aids and i was very careful. One of the first men i went out with is a doctor who specializes in aids  asked if Gobie could provide names of other prominent politicians with whom he had relations. Frank said "1 Don t know if you can Trust him. And i Don t know who he s going to say was in my Kitchen. I m vulnerable and other people arc  Frank s dealings with Gobic arc being investigated by the House ethics panel. The congressman has said that after ending his sexual relationship with Gobic he hired him in 1985 As a person Al aide to help him Start a new life. Frank said he used his own Money not congressional staff funds. But he said he fired Gobie in 1987 after he Learned that the aide was run Ning a prostitution ring out of Frank s apartment. Frank 49, revealed his homosexual Ity in june 1987. The following year he was re elected with 70 percent of the vote from his predominantly democratic Southeastern Massachusetts  the revelation about his relationship with Gobic has prompted Calls for the congressman to quit including one this week from the Boston sunday Globe. It said Frank should resign for his own Good and for the Good of his Consitt tents his causes and  the Issue of Frank s conduct is not homosexuality but prostitution which is illegal and which has always been destructive Clement in heterosexual and homosexual life the newspaper said. Had the Issue been heterosexual prostitution feminist groups would not have been silent. So tar Frank has enjoyed More than the Benefit of the doubt he has enjoyed a double Stan  in the Newsweek interview Frank said he would not resign because that would among other things Short circuit the ethics procedure. It s very important to have that go  has said however that he would consider not running for re election if the incident begins to seriously Hurt the lib eral causes he believes in. Suva Fiji a an american team landed monday on a deserted Pacific Island where it believes Amelia ear Hart crashed in her 1937 attempt to Fly around the world the expedition Leader said. There was no immediate sign of any wreckage Richard Gillespie head of the International group for historic air Craft research told his base Camp in Fiji from a ship off the Island of Nik Umaro to 1,000 Miles to the East Gillespic s Wilmington  group will spend the next three weeks searching Nikuma Roro in the Kiribati archipelago. Near the Beach the vegetation is very dense and easily could have hidden an aircraft from Aerial searches he said of attempts 52 years ago to locate the american Pilot alter she crashed. The 16 expedition members including naval historians divers and archaeologists left Fiji a week ago aboard a converted japanese trawler the Pacific Nomad. After spending the past two years try ing to resolve a mystery that has con founded experts for decades they concluded that Earhart must have crash landed on Nikuma Roro instead of her in tended Stopover destination of Howland Amelia Earhart Island 500 Miles to the North. Gillespic said that if she crashed on the Island at Low tide she would have stood a Good Chance of surviving for Brief time Nikuma Roro also known As Gardner is uninhabited and without fresh water. The group believes Earhart managed to Send distress signals for about three Days before dying of  arc All very exhilarated and in Awe of the Beauty of the place he  of us have Ever seen a place so wild As  said the a shaped Island is Home to a huge amount of  of every description Circle the Island and Black lipped Sharks Are inconstant attendance. There Are fish turtles and dolphins in  disappeared in 1937 after Tak ing off from Papua new Guinea jus North of Australia in an attempt to make the first circumnavigation of the worldly plane. Her exploits achieved legendary status in the United states. The flier was 6,820 Miles Short of her goal when she and navigator Fred Noonan vanished. The expedition to find her remains which has Cost $250,000 so far was spurred by research conducted by by women from fort Walton Beach Fla. Tom Willi a former Navy Pilot an Tom Gannon a retired air Force Taviga  studied aircraft navigation of the 1930s to plot a probable course followed by Earhart. Their research pointed to Ward Nikuma Roro. Accident kills go during nato exercise. 0 Vicenza.
